✅ The Stanley R. Mickelsen Safeguard Complex near Nekoma, North Dakota, cost around $5.7 billion and had a radar system that resembled the shape of a pyramid. ❌ However, the base remained operational until Feb. 10, 1976.
In the video, @benben.son said that the site “cost $6 billion to make” but “was only operational for a single day”:
“There was a year or so in the mid-’70s during which the base had its full complement of personnel — 500 military and 1,200 civilians,” the Post reported. “Its 200-unit subdivision was full of military people and their families. Its commissary was running. Its all-faiths chapel was planning an addition.”Dates of OperationA 1971 photograph of construction on the radar system for the Mickelsen Safeguard Complex. An “escape tunnel” is pictured below.
On Nov. 24, 1975, the El Paso Herald-Post published that the first of 12 planned bases was essentially used as a “bargaining chip” with Russia. That country was purportedly impressed with the base in North Dakota. The Kremlin saw what that $5.8 billion was buying and agreed to limit Russia and the United States to one ABM site each, thus saving the United States untold billions. Seen in that light, Safeguard was a multibillion-dollar bargaining chip that worked.
